Creating WebBlocker exceptions
WebBlocker provides an exceptions control to override any
of the WebBlocker settings. Exceptions take precedence
over all other WebBlocker rules; you can add sites that you
want to be allowed or denied above and beyond other
WebBlocker settings. Sites listed as exceptions apply only
to HTTP traffic and are not related to the Blocked Sites list.
The exceptions option maintains a list of IP addresses that
you want to either specifically allow or deny, regardless of
other WebBlocker settings. You can specify exceptions by
domain name, network address, or host IP address. You
can also fine-tune your exceptions by specifying a port
number, path name, or string which is to be blocked for a
particular Web site. For example, if you wanted to block
only
www.sharedspace.com/~dave
, because Dave’s site con-
tains nude pictures, you would enter “
~dave
” to block that
directory of
sharedspace.com
. This would still allow users to
have access to
www.sharedspace.com/~julia
, which contains
a helpful article on increasing productivity.
If you wanted to block any sexually explicit content that
might be on
sharedspace.com
, you might enter
*sex
, to
block a Web page such as
www.sharedspace.com/~george/
sexy.htm
. By placing an asterisk (*) in front of the string you
want to match, it will be matched if that string appears
anywhere in the location part of the URL. However, you
cannot enter
*sex
in the pattern section, and expect to
block all URLs that contain the word “sex.” The * option
can be used only to modify the exceptions within a specific
URL. For example, you can block
www.sharedspace.com/
*sex
and expect that
www.sharedspace/sexsite.html
will be
blocked.
N
OTE
This WebBlocker features is applicable only for outbound
requests to access web sites. You cannot use WebBlocker
exceptions to make an internal host exempt from
WebBlocker rules.
